SEATTLE, WA--(Marketwire - October 15, 2007) - Leading UHF Gen 2 radio frequency
identification (RFID) tag chip and reader supplier Impinj, Inc. today
announced the appointment of Leon de Ridder as Director of Sales for the
regions of Europe, the Middle East and Africa (EMEA).
Based in Zeewolde, the Netherlands, de Ridder joins Impinj after more than
a decade at Omron Corporation (based in Kyoto, Japan), where he was most
recently General Manager of the company's European RFID Division. He also
held positions at Omron in Europe as General Manager, Advanced Modules
Business Division and Sales Manager, Electronic Components Division. He
holds degrees in Electrical Engineering and Business Administration from
Saxion Hogescholen, the Netherlands.
De Ridder's primary responsibilities are to direct Impinj's EMEA sales
operations and growing channel support/reseller network. He will also
direct Impinj's EMEA field applications engineering group headed by Senior
Field Applications Engineer, Fabrice Zecca, who is based in Roquefort les
Pins, France.

About Impinj, Inc.
Impinj, Inc. is a semiconductor and RFID company whose patented
Self-Adaptive Silicon® technology enables two synergistic business lines:
high-performance RFID solutions and semiconductor intellectual property
(IP). Impinj is the leading technical innovator in developing UHF RFID
solutions for both item-level and supply-chain tagging worldwide. Impinj
draws on its technical expertise and industry partnerships to deliver the
GrandPrix™ RFID solution comprising high-performance tags, readers,
software, antennas, and systems integration. Impinj also licenses
innovative IP products to leading semiconductor companies worldwide,
allowing them to seamlessly integrate crucial nonvolatile memory (NVM)
alongside analog and digital functionality on a single chip. Impinj's IP
products include the popular AEON® family of embeddable cores, which
provide rewriteable NVM technology in logic CMOS manufacturing. For more
information, visit www.impinj.com.
